Direct Interview definition

Direct Interview means qualifying applicants go directly to oral interviews and are placed on the list, if appropriate.
Direct Interview means admission to a selection eligibility pool through a procedure that is based on an applicant criterion conforming to paragraph (H) of rule 5101:11-4-01 and that constitutes an exception to the regular selection procedure for the respective occupation course.
